The cup is an English unit of volume, most commonly associated with cooking and serving sizes. It is traditionally equal to half a liquid pint in either US customary units or the British imperial system but is now separately defined in terms of the metric system at values between 1⁄5 and 1⁄4 of a liter. Because actual drinking cups may differ greatly from the size of this unit, standard measuring cups are usually used instead. In the United States, the customary cup is half of a liquid pint or 8 U.S. customary fluid ounces. One customary cup is equal to 236.5882365 millilitres.

Convert 50 mL to Cups

To convert 50 mL to cups we must divide the volume in milliliters by the cup size: The 50 mL to cups formula is [cups] = 50 / cup size. Thus, we get the following results:
50 mL to cups =

  • 0.21134 US customary cups
  • 0.20833 United States legal cups
  • 0.2 Metric cups
  • 0.21997 Canadian cups
  • 0.17598 Imperial cups

Note that these results for 50mL to cups have been rounded to five decimals. If you are unsure which cup unit you have check our home page for additional information.

Make sure to understand that the substance or food doesn’t go into the equation because the density is irrelevant for a volume to volume conversion like 50 mls to cups.It follows that 50 mL water to cups is the same as, for example, 50 mL milk to cups.

How do you measure 50ml in cups?

To convert ml to cups, you can take the number of milliliters and divide by 237. So 50 ml divided by 237 approximately equals 1/4 cup.

What size is 50 ml?

The alcohol bottle size known as a nip is also called a mini and contains 50 ml of alcohol. That's about 1.7 ounces and approximately one 1.5-ounce shot.
